Q1: Can I use non-dairy milk in espresso machines with frothers?

Yes, many espresso machines can froth non-dairy milk like almond, soy, or oat milk. However, the frothing efficiency might differ depending on the type of milk used.

Q2: Is it worth purchasing a super-automatic espresso machine?

If benefit and ease of use are your top priorities, a super-automatic machine may be worth the investment. It automates every action of the process, making it easy to delight in espresso and frothed milk drinks.

Q4: What is the distinction between a steam wand and an automatic frother?

A steam wand allows manual control of the frothing process, while an automatic frother manages everything for you, typically creating consistent froth with less effort.
